Create shadow instance in the secure tenant

Description

Using instance sharing API (spike https://folio-org.atlassian.net/browse/MCBFF-60), when creating an ECS request, create instance shadow in the secure tenant. More formally,

WHEN Three-request case (Primary + Secondary + Intermediate)
AND Primary request should be created in the non-Central tenant (always the case in the three-request case)
THEN Before creating Primary request, create Shadow instance in the same tenant where Primary request should be created

Note. Check https://folio-org.atlassian.net/browse/MCBFF-60 comment section for more information about the results of the spike and how instance sharing API should be used.

Environment

None

Potential Workaround

None

Attachments

2
  • 18 Feb 2025, 05:26 PM
  • 18 Feb 2025, 10:23 AM

Confluence content

mentioned on

Checklist

hide

Activity

Show:

Oleksandr Hrusha February 18, 2025 at 5:26 PM

Checked on bugfest, works as expected

2025-02-18_19h24_35.mp4

Oleksandr Hrusha February 18, 2025 at 10:23 AM

Done

Details

Assignee

Reporter

Priority

Story Points

Sprint

Development Team

Vega

Fix versions

Release

Ramsons (R2 2024) Service Patch #1

TestRail: Cases

Open TestRail: Cases

TestRail: Runs

Open TestRail: Runs

Created February 7, 2025 at 1:40 PM
Updated February 21, 2025 at 4:23 PM
Resolved February 18, 2025 at 10:49 AM
TestRail: Cases
TestRail: Runs

Flag notifications